From: Michael Tremer Date: Sat, 13 Mar 2021 17:48:16 +0000 (+0000) Subject: repo: baseurl is a pointer X-Git-Tag: 0.9.28~1285^2~530 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=6eb523a29e59ec69db9100bb36a69988da586322;p=pakfire.git repo: baseurl is a pointer Signed-off-by: Michael Tremer --- diff --git a/src/libpakfire/repo.c b/src/libpakfire/repo.c index c388972b3..945b1952e 100644 --- a/src/libpakfire/repo.c +++ b/src/libpakfire/repo.c @@ -84,20 +84,18 @@ Id pakfire_repo_add_solvable(PakfireRepo repo) { } static struct pakfire_downloader* pakfire_repo_downloader(PakfireRepo repo) { - const char* mirrorlist = repo->appdata->mirrorlist; - if (!repo->downloader) { int r = pakfire_downloader_create(&repo->downloader, repo->pakfire); if (r) return NULL; // Set baseurl - if (*repo->appdata->baseurl) + if (repo->appdata->baseurl) pakfire_downloader_set_baseurl(repo->downloader, repo->appdata->baseurl); // Load all mirrors (if the mirrorlist exists) - if (*mirrorlist && pakfire_path_exists(mirrorlist)) { - r = pakfire_downloader_read_mirrorlist(repo->downloader, mirrorlist); + if (repo->appdata->mirrorlist && pakfire_path_exists(repo->appdata->mirrorlist)) { + r = pakfire_downloader_read_mirrorlist(repo->downloader, repo->appdata->mirrorlist); if (r) return NULL; }